What is an SSDI Benefit Calculator?
The SSDI Benefit Calculator is an online tool that estimates the Social Security Disability Insurance benefits you could receive. By inputting your average monthly earnings, current age, number of dependents, and years worked, the calculator provides:
- Estimated Monthly Benefit: How much you may receive each month.
- Estimated Annual Benefit: The total amount you may receive in a year.
- Work Years and Dependents Overview: Helps contextualize your benefits based on your history and family responsibilities.

Example Calculation
Let’s look at an example to illustrate how the SSDI Benefit Calculator works:
- Average Monthly Earnings: $4,000
- Current Age: 45
- Number of Dependents: 2
- Years Worked: 20
After entering this information and clicking “Calculate,” the tool may display:
- Estimated Monthly Benefit: $1,800
- Estimated Annual Benefit: $21,600
- Total Dependents: 2
- Work Years: 20
This gives you a clear picture of what to expect, helping you plan finances and understand potential SSDI payments before officially applying.
